Pawan, Too, Ending Up Like A Pappu?

Pawan, Too, Ending Up Like A Pappu?

Power star and Jana Sena Party president Pawan Kalyan always claims that he is a voracious reader of books and most of his knowledge has come from the number of books he has read.

He quotes extensively from the statements of philosophers to poets to politicians, but most of the times, it was evident that he was reading out from the prepared script.

But once he comes into active politics, he needs to do a lot of homework before he makes statements in public and should not fumble while speaking, lest he would become another Nara Lokesh, who always does faux pas in his public speeches.

For that, Lokesh has earned the sobriquet of “pappu” from rival parties and also a section of media.

The other day, Pawan also gave the impression that he is becoming another pappu. During his meeting with party workers at his Jana Sena office in Hyderabad, Pawan sprang a surprise on them by asking them to take inspiration from Albert Einstein who had invented electric bulb.

“Einstein has invented electric bulb and he should be your inspiration,” he said.

Everybody was shocked as they were all well aware that it was Thomas Alva Edison and not Albert Einstein who invented the electric bulb.

It’s better Pawan Kalyan does his homework properly before making such statements.
